Meta Reality Labs brings together an R&D team of researchers, developers, and engineers with the shared goal of developing the next generation of XR experiences across the spectrum. Our World AI Research team explores, develops, publishes, and delivers novel and cutting-edge technologies for creating photorealistic 3D and 4D worlds from large-scale and heterogeneous data sources. Our team is addressing a variety of technical challenges including generative world foundation model development, static and dynamic reconstruction using radiance fields, semantic scene understanding, and related domains. We're looking for candidates who share a passion for exploring and solving complex, challenging problems at the intersection of generative modeling and photorealistic 3D/4D reconstruction. The aim of this role is to develop, advance, and support the technology maturing process of state of the art research in 3D/4D Generative AI technologies.
